Transaction e62f5c8a51663080980e33b55b24bdf20495a7dd263fad4945b557ef4274b46d
1 Input
1 Output
-
e62f5c8a51663080980e33b55b24bdf20495a7dd263fad4945b557ef4274b46d:0
- value
- 1396976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 388220c7bfd65352b9881bc04bbf782999dcbca2 OP_EQUAL
- address
- 36qoejxn3sYXhLdMSn3vzueEf3gvbf9SRo